Warning Signs

How To Tell If Your System Is About To Fail

A little attention to how your system is running can save you a lot of money and discomfort.

Unusual Noises

A healthy system runs with a consistent, low hum — banging, screeching, or grinding usually points to a loose part or failing motor.

Weak or Uneven Airflow

This is one of the most common complaints we hear on service calls across Mount Morris.

Energy Costs Climbing With No Explanation

A system working harder than it should to hit the same temperature shows up directly on your utility bill.

Short Cycling

A system that won't hold a steady cycle is often fighting a sizing issue, a thermostat problem, or a refrigerant imbalance.

Musty, Burning, or Chemical Smells

A burning smell should never be ignored — it can indicate an electrical issue that needs immediate attention.

Why Systems Fail

What's Usually Behind A Breakdown

None of these are unusual or embarrassing — they're just the normal wear and tear that comes with running a system through Mount Morris's seasonal swings.

Airflow RestrictionThe single most common cause of reduced airflow and frozen coils, and the easiest to prevent
Low Refrigerant ChargeA system low on refrigerant loses cooling capacity and puts extra strain on the compressor
Worn Start ComponentsCapacitors and contactors wear out from routine cycling and are a frequent cause of a system that won't start
Thermostat MalfunctionsA thermostat that's lost calibration or has a wiring fault can make an otherwise healthy system seem broken
Seasonal Tips

What Mount Morris Weather Does To Your Equipment

Homeowners who schedule a tune-up ahead of each season tend to call us far less often for emergency repairs. Filters should be checked monthly during heavy-use seasons and replaced roughly every 60-90 days depending on your household and any pets.

Clearing debris, leaves, and overgrown landscaping away from an outdoor condenser unit gives it room to breathe and keeps it running efficiently. None of this replaces a professional tune-up, but it does reduce the wear that leads to premature breakdowns between visits.

Benjamin Pearson was the first settler in the area in 1833. In 1836, Frederick Walker was the first to settle within the future village site. A post office named Mount Morris was established on July 11, 1837, with Charles N. Beecher as the first postmaster. The name of the office was changed to Genesee on January 19, 1839, and back to Mount Morris on April 25, 1857. The name became Mount Morris Station on April 17, 1865, and finally reverted to Mount Morris on March 9, 1874. Development was spurred with the building of a line of the Pere Marquette Railway (now owned by Lake State Railway) in 1857. The settlement was first platted as Dover in 1862 and was incorporated as the village of Mount Morris in 1867. It reincorporated as a city in 1929.
